  • 由恩佐·法拉利在1983年9月公布,并在1983年9月的日内瓦车展上露面,GTO(非正式场合加上288前缀)受到了极大的追捧。其颇具历史含义的名称、Pininfarina的特有造型、提供无限动力的发动机(2.8升和8缸)以及复合材料的广泛使用,让GTO在市场上成为与赛车最为接近的车型,很大程度上是因为这正是它诞生的初衷。

    众所周知,法拉利288 GTO的设计是为了参加后来被取消的B组拉力赛,当时针对进口认证目的而满足两百辆的数量要求。但根据法拉利工程师和288 GTO之父尼古拉·马特拉齐的说法,该项目早于B组的规定。他说,GTO的诞生源于恩佐·法拉利担心他的公路车已经失去了太多优势。无论其诞生的原因是什么,GTO从未参加过比赛。B组由于安全原因被取消,但法拉利坚持了下来。这款车在日内瓦车展上的亮相引起了轰动,甚至在开始生产之前就已售罄。一位潜在买家非常想要一辆GTO,以至于他花了2万瑞士法郎买了一份文件,证明如果这款车完工,他将购买201号。他很幸运。最终,法拉利在1984-86年间共生产了272辆GTO。尽管如此,每个经销商得到的车不会超过一辆,而且必须亲自挑选一个客户才能得到法拉利的认可。大多数都拍出了远高于要价的价格。站在今天来看,当时的价格非常划算,因为288 GTO就像它20世纪60年代的前辈一样,现在是收藏家市场上的珍品。

    尽管在视觉上它与当时的系列车型没有什么惊人的不同,但GTO确实吸引了人们的想象力,Pininfarina设计的车身采用了老派的方法;设计师们把他们的初步草图直接带到车间,省去了当时新兴的计算机辅助设计。喇叭形挡泥板、扰流板和前后多个进气口让这辆车的姿态更激进: 308加强版。虽然基于308系列的轮廓,但两者使用的部件很少相同。GTO深受F1车队的影响,使用了高强度钢空间框架,凯夫拉纤维,玻璃纤维和铝。它的400马力,2855cc V8发动机定义了它的非官方名称,粉丝将其命名为“288”,以区别于传奇的250 GTO。动力装置是纵向安装的,以改善其1160公斤的重量分布,这使得辅助装置、变速箱和双IHI涡轮增压器能够更有效地包装,尽管Pininfarina的设计主管莱昂纳多·费奥拉凡蒂仍然必须将轴距拉长11厘米,并加宽履带。尽管如此,GTO还是比308短了5毫米,因为减少了后悬垂。这也是第一个法拉利已经安装了双涡轮增压器。288的最高时速为189英里/小时(305公里/小时),在4.9秒内加速到62英里/小时(100公里/小时)。不管它的赛车出身如何,GTO都配备了适合道路使用的设备,皮革装饰的座椅是标准的,还有电动窗户和空调等选项。
